The film tells the story of Bruno Sulak (Lucas Bravo), a real-life one-time parachutist and Foreign Legion deserter who captured the imagination of the French in the early 1980s with a string of increasingly high-profile robberies (as well as the occasional prison break) that led many to see him as a flesh-and-blood version of Arsene Lupin, the beloved fictional gentleman thief.
